The Science Behind Our Tile Floor Water Extraction Process

A proper water extraction process involves more than just sucking up the water. Our team uses specialized equipment to remove water from your tile floor, including moisture meters to ensure every drop is removed. This is crucial to preventing mold growth and structural damage. We then use drying protocols to speed up the evaporation process, ensuring your floor is dry and safe within 3-5 days.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ians arrive quickly to assess the damage and contain the affected area. This prevents further damage and ensures a safe working environment. We use specialized equipment to contain the water and prevent it from spreading.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team uses advanced equipment to extract water from your tile floor, including wet vacuums and pumps. This process is crucial to removing as much water as possible and preventing further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ment to speed up the evaporation process, ensuring your floor is dry and safe within 3-5 days. This is essential to pre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

Our team cleans and disinfects your tile floor to prevent mold growth and ensure a safe living environment. This is a critical step in the restoration process.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ion

Our technicians perform a final inspection to ensure your tile floor is completely dry and safe. This is our guarantee to you that the job is done right.

Tile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

SituationDIY?Call a Pro?Why
Small water leak (less than 1 gallon)YesNoDI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to monitor the situation closely.
Visible mold growthNoYesMold growth needs professional attention to prevent further health problems.
Water damage to your tile floor (buckling, warping, or discoloration)NoYesWater damage needs professional attention to prevent further structural problems.
Large water leak (more than 1 gallon)NoYesLarge water leaks need profess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ment.
Unpleasant odors or musty smellsNoYesUnpleasant odors or musty smells can be a sign of mold growth, which needs professional attention.
Water damage to your baseboards or wallsNoYesWater damage to your baseboards or walls needs professional attention to prevent further structural problems.
